Sabrina Carpenter (26) caused a stir with her new album "Man's Best Friend", which was released on Friday. Especially the cover of the album caused discussions: The singer is on her hands and knees, while a man holds her blond hair in his hand. Many saw in it a controversial expression, which the singer counters with humor and determination.
